J & S Service Center
Claimed

Address 3303 Portage Ave, South Bend, IN 46628, USA, South Bend, Indiana, United States 46628

Phone(574) 277-8175

Automotive Services

Vehicle Repair Shop South Bend IN

J & S Service Center is a expert Vehicle Repair Shop in South Bend IN. We handle diagnostics, brakes, suspension & more with precision, using quality parts and honest service you can trust. Get back on the road with confidence, call or book your appointment today.

Dylan Wright

J-S+Service+Center+Vector+Logo_NO+WEB+ADDRESS-144w
Claimed
Be the first to review!

Social Links

Business location

You might also be interested in